Servir’s Disaster management

Volcanoes: servir-viz helps to monitor volcanoes and their status. There are many other volcanoes related products are available through which you can take advance warning related to volcanoes and their status. These products of servir has been developed by SERVIR research affiliate SSAI, and a "Volcano Cam" plug in for SERVIR-VIZ that allows users to view live-web cams of select many volcanoes of the countries

Earthquakes: Many countries are located in a seismically active region. Tectonic pressures from the conjunction of five plates result in numerous earthquakes and active volcanoes. All these plates are creating volcanoes and triggering earthquakes. Earthquakes of magnitude 5 and above since 1900 are shown by the red and green circles on the images at right corner and Volcanoes which are active and dangerous are shown in yellow triangles

Food Security: Many Countries have developed Food Security Early Warning System Network (MFEWS) which strengthens the ability of foreign countries and regional organizations to manage risk of food insecurity through the availability of timely and analytical early warning and vulnerability information

Landslides: The combination of heavy rain, steep slopes, and, in some cases, deforestation, makes landslides a serious risk in many countries. Many countries are now mapping vulnerable landslides areas that result in many catastrophic accidents. Landslides occurring in populated areas can destroy buildings, take lives, and permanently alter the landscape

In response to the need to better plan for landslide events, SERVIR research partner SSAI has developed a prototype regional landslide susceptibility map. In which Landslide Susceptibility is identified using slope and elevation known to correspond with landslide events

The preliminary product of Servir developed to test the usefulness of this methodology for identifying regional susceptibility to landslides. You can see some of links on Servir’s website and the metadata which is also available on the SERVIR‘s website

Weather Forecasting: Servir is now taking help from many satellites which gives real time satellite images These satellites can be GOES-12 satellite which is a geostationary-based remote sensing platform located at 75 degrees west longitude at the equator and is approximately 22,000 miles above the earth. GOES-12 can observe cloud systems in visible and infrared light as well as determining the vertical temperature structure of the atmosphere

Meteorologists and analysts use GOES-12 to monitor cloud motions and thunderstorms to help forecast day-to-day weather conditions and to warn the public of severe storms. GOES-12 data and images are updated in every 30 minutes under normal operations. These satellite images and data also useful to track and monitor in crops cultivation which is totally depend up weather conditions and their future estimation

Real-time and historical GOES images can be viewed, animated, and downloaded from the Real-time Image Viewer of Servir-Viz. GOES imagery can be used with other regional weather predictions and products and data using the free SERVIR-VIZ applications

SERVIR is a regional visualization and monitoring system for many countries that uses and integrates satellite and other geospatial data and images for improved scientific knowledge and get help for decision making for managers, researchers, students, and the general public.
